Slutty Brownies: The Ultimate Three-Layer Bar

Tips for the Best Slutty Brownies

  • If you prefer a super fudgy brownie top, slightly underbake them and chill the cooled pan for a bit before slicing; this helps them set and gives cleaner cuts.
  • For extra chocolate, stir a handful of chocolate chips into the brownie batter before pouring it over the Oreos.
  • If your cookie dough is very firm, let it soften at room temperature so it presses into the pan easily.
  • A metal pan typically bakes brownies more evenly and produces chewier edges than glass.

FAQs

Can I make slutty brownies from scratch instead of using mixes?
Yes. You can use homemade chocolate chip cookie dough and your favorite from‑scratch brownie batter. Just keep the proportions similar: a thin but even cookie layer on the bottom, a single layer of Oreos in the middle, and enough brownie batter to cover them fully.

Do I have to use Oreos, or can I swap another cookie?
Oreos are classic for this recipe, but you can substitute other sandwich cookies, flavored Oreos, or even chocolate‑filled cookies. Just keep them roughly the same size so they fit in a single layer.

How do I store slutty brownies?
Store cooled brownies in an airtight container at room temperature for up to 3 days. For longer storage, refrigerate them for up to 5 days or freeze individual squares tightly wrapped for up to 2 months. Let frozen brownies thaw at room temperature or warm them briefly in the microwave before serving.

Can I double the recipe for a crowd?
Absolutely. Double all the ingredients and bake in a 9×13‑inch pan. The baking time may increase slightly; start checking around 40 minutes and continue until the center is set with just a bit of fudginess.

How can I tell if they’re done when there are three layers?
Check a few spots near the center with a toothpick. It should come out with moist crumbs from the brownie layer but not with raw, shiny batter. The cookie base will continue to firm up as the brownies cool.

Conclusion and Call to Action

Slutty brownies are the ultimate mash‑up dessert: chewy cookie base, crunchy‑creamy Oreos in the middle, and a thick, fudgy brownie top all baked together in one pan. They’re easy to throw together with pantry shortcuts, yet they slice up into bars that look and taste like something you spent all afternoon making.
